Rzeczownik A1 entity
1

time spent relaxing or sleeping

A time when you stop working or moving so you can relax or sleep.

Schemat użycia: take [a/an] rest
Częsty błąd:
Learners sometimes confuse 'rest' (noun) with 'nap' (noun); 'nap' usually means sleeping for a short time, while 'rest' can mean relaxing without sleeping.
Synonimy
break (Often refers to a short pause during work or activity.) | repose (More formal or literary term for rest, often implying calmness.)
Antonimy
work (The opposite of stopping activity; involves effort or labor.) | activity (The opposite of stillness or inactivity.)
Kolokacje
get some rest |take a rest |need a rest |well-deserved rest
Tematy
daily life |health |work |daily_life |core_vocabulary
Przykłady
  • After the long hike, we all needed a good rest.
  • She lay down for a short rest before dinner.
  • The doctor advised him to take plenty of rest to recover.

Czasownik A1 action
2

stop to relax or sleep

To stop working or moving so you can relax or sleep.

Schemat użycia: to rest [for time/duration]
Częsty błąd:
Learners may confuse 'rest' (verb) with 'sleep'; sleeping is one way to rest, but resting can also mean simply relaxing without sleeping.
Synonimy
relax (Focuses more on mental ease and comfort rather than physical recovery.) | pause (Often refers to a brief stop without necessarily relaxing.)
Antonimy
work (To engage in physical or mental activity instead of stopping.) | exert oneself (To use physical or mental energy actively.)
Kolokacje
rest for a while |rest your eyes |rest after work
Tematy
daily life |health |daily_life |core_vocabulary
Przykłady
  • We decided to rest for an hour before continuing our trip.
  • She rested in bed after the operation.
  • You should rest your eyes after looking at the screen for too long.

Rzeczownik A2 entity
3

the remaining part of something

What is left after other parts are gone or used.

Schemat użycia: the rest of [something]
Częsty błąd:
Learners sometimes confuse 'rest' in this sense with 'break'; here it means 'remaining part', not 'pause'.
Synonimy
remainder (More formal; often used in written contexts.) | balance (Used especially for amounts of money left over.)
Antonimy
whole (Refers to the complete amount rather than what is left.)
Kolokacje
the rest of the day |the rest of the money |the rest of them
Tematy
daily life |core_vocabulary
Przykłady
  • I’ll eat the rest of the cake later.
  • She spent the rest of her life in the countryside.
  • We need to finish the rest of the project tomorrow.

Czasownik B1 action
4

place on something for support

To put something so it is held up by another thing.

Schemat użycia: rest [something] on [something]
Synonimy
lean (Implies support at an angle rather than lying flat.) | lay (More general term for putting something down; may not imply support.)
Kolokacje
rest your head on a pillow |rest your hand on the table
Tematy
daily life |daily_life |core_vocabulary
Przykłady
  • She rested her head on his shoulder.
  • The ladder was resting against the wall.
  • He rested his elbows on the desk.

Czasownik B2 relation
5

depend on something for support or basis

To depend on something for support or reason.

Schemat użycia: rest on [something]
Synonimy
depend on (More general; can apply to many contexts of reliance.) | rely on (Implies trust and dependence.)
Kolokacje
rest on evidence |rest on assumptions
Tematy
ideas |law |core_vocabulary
Przykłady
  • The case rests on one key witness.
  • His argument rests on false assumptions.
  • Our success rests on teamwork.
